Meloxicam, like all NSAIDs, may exacerbate hypertension and congestive heart failure and may cause an increased risk of serious cardiovascular thromboembolism, acute myocardial infarction, and stroke, which can be fatal. Meloxicam (Mobic) is a prescription drug used for treating pain and inflammation of osteoarthritis, rheumatoid, juvenile and idiopathic arthritis. How to use Mobic.
